]> git.lizzy.rs Git - plan9front.git/commit - sys/man/2/9p
9p(2): correct usage for srvrelease()/srvacquire()
authorcinap_lenrek <cinap_lenrek@gmx.de>
Thu, 17 Oct 2013 06:26:05 +0000 (08:26 +0200)
committercinap_lenrek <cinap_lenrek@gmx.de>
Thu, 17 Oct 2013 06:26:05 +0000 (08:26 +0200)
commite30f50283c60e21763aa28def66deab70ae12187
treeaa363f0055ddf293b894c3141820fdc35f8dec40
parent52fc6d50d49b95e4598e2c9bb65e15e37035bf28
9p(2): correct usage for srvrelease()/srvacquire()

the process is *NOT* allowed to exit after a srvrelease() as
it still holds a reference (srv->rref) preventing the srv
from beging freed/ended (listensrv) before srvacquire().
sys/man/2/9p